The method that self-inspection after intelligent vehicle Chinese herbaceous peony according to embodiments of the present invention is described below with reference to Fig. 3.
Fig. 3 shows the overview flow chart of the method 300 of self-inspection after intelligent vehicle Chinese herbaceous peony according to embodiments of the present invention.
As shown in figure 3, in the step 310, intelligent vehicle 100 is received via wireless communication unit and managed from intelligent vehicle The user of platform uses car reservation information.
Specifically, usual Intelligent Vehicle System is operated as follows:For example, user terminal of each user via oneself, such as hand Machine, ipad or desktop computer etc., submission is asked with car;Intelligent vehicle management platform 10 manages the status information of each vehicle, receives Carry out being distributed with car to after being asked with car;Receiving the intelligent vehicle 100 for distributing task with car can check own operating condition, After confirming fault-free, can show with ready reception to the response of intelligent vehicle management platform 10.
In step 320, intelligent vehicle uses Chinese herbaceous peony article condition using sensor inspection therein.
In one example, check that the use Chinese herbaceous peony article condition of therein includes:Check boot, in-car storage space And the article condition around seat.In one example, article condition is felt by camera or infrared sensor in boot Survey;Article condition on seat is sensed by pressure sensor;The article condition of ground passes through camera or infrared before seat Sensor is sensed.Camera shoots the image for obtaining user with Chinese herbaceous peony in-car relevant portion;Pressure sensor obtains user and uses The pressure that Chinese herbaceous peony seat applies;Infrared ray sensor can sense the infrared ray of object release, the object release of different temperatures Ultrared wavelength is different, and infrared ray sensor can sense the ultrared wavelength of object release, can thereby distinguish difference Object.
The type of the sensor is merely illustrative, it is possible to use other types of sensor, such as optical sensor, sound are passed Sensor etc..The deployment scenarios of the sensor are merely illustrative, can optionally be arranged, such as not only in the car in seat Arrangement pressure sensor, and all arrange pressure sensor in storage space, boot etc..
In a step 330, go to meet user before intelligent vehicle is driven automatically, then complete user and be sent to task.
It should be noted that user here is sent to task should be interpreted broadly, including passenger is transported, also including transporting Goods.
The route along planning is needed herein in relation to intelligent vehicle, this can be carried out by intelligent vehicle itself, it is also possible to Carried out by intelligent vehicle management platform, this non-invention emphasis, not described in detail here.
In step 340, the instruction and/or operation got off in response to user, intelligent vehicle check itself using sensor It is internal with article condition after car.
In one example, the instruction and/or operation that user gets off can press the button of getting off on getting off, and be sent out with mobile phone Go out order of getting off, or send the voice command got off, make action of opening car door etc..
In one example, the instruction and/or operation got off in response to user, check therein with article after car State includes:Check the article condition around boot, in-car storage space and seat.With above similar, the article on seat State can be sensed by pressure sensor;The article condition of ground is felt by camera or infrared sensor before seat Survey;And article condition is sensed by camera or infrared sensor in boot.
It should be noted that the article condition of in-car be not limited on seat, the thing before seat on the ground and in boot Product state, can include the article condition of other positions, if such as in-car is provided with special material-putting space, such as hang clothing Place, then can sense the article condition of relevant position.
In step 350, compare with Chinese herbaceous peony article condition and with article condition after car, and based on difference feelings between the two Condition, carries out respective handling.
It should be noted that unless otherwise instructed, here " compare with Chinese herbaceous peony article condition and with article condition after car, and Based on difference condition between the two, respective handling is carried out " can be performed by intelligent vehicle itself, it is also possible to joined by intelligent vehicle Close the external world to carry out, the external world can be such as intelligent vehicle management platform here, but can also be other computing resources etc.;This In intelligent vehicle joint it is extraneous, both calculated including intelligent vehicle or executable portion or similar operations and remaining is calculated or similar behaviour Work is carried out by the external world, and also including calculating or similar operations are mainly carried out by the external world, and intelligent vehicle carries out connecing for relevant data The operation received and send.Preferably, in order to vehicle response speed considers, aforesaid operations are locally executed in intelligent vehicle.
In one example, compare with Chinese herbaceous peony article condition and with article condition after car, and based on difference between the two Situation, carrying out respective handling includes:Based on the difference between article condition after Chinese herbaceous peony, determine user whether lost objects, and It is determined that in the case of lost objects, notifying user.Specifically, can include:Compare with Chinese herbaceous peony and with the boot after car, car Article condition around interior storage space and seat, and determine whether relevant position has article to have more, so that it is determined that user whether In the relevant position lost objects.
For example, the use Chinese herbaceous peony article condition sensed for camera and use that can respectively to capture with article condition after car Chinese herbaceous peony image and characterized with image after car, then can carry out image comparison, compare the difference between two images, it is determined that depositing In the case of difference, and the position where orienting difference.Again for example, for sense seating pressure pressure sensor, can With compare pressure sensor sensing use Chinese herbaceous peony pressure and with pressure after car, if be significantly greater than using Chinese herbaceous peony pressure with pressure after car Power, then be likely to user and lost article on the seat.Again for example, for the sensing result of infrared ray sensor, can compare The wavelength of the use Chinese herbaceous peony of sensing and with wavelength after car, if both are significantly different, then be likely to user and lose in corresponding site Article.
In one example, it is determined that in the case of user's lost objects, carry out respective handling can include it is following in It is at least one:Vehicle itself sends caution sound;Vehicle itself sends warning light;Prompting letter is sent to the hand-held mobile terminal of user Breath.Such as, if in the range of the scheduled time, such as in 10 seconds, vehicle sends warning automatically, for example, blow a whistle or provide voice Prompting such as " Mr. Wang little Ming, you fall in boot at thing ", or even sends short message to Client handset, or is beaten to Client handset Phone.
It should be noted that it is above-mentioned with state self-inspection after Chinese herbaceous peony, compare, find user's lost objects when warn, be all Completed in the very fast time, for example, warn and made in the several seconds for making action of getting off in user, enabled a user to When not yet away from vehicle (such as just having left several steps remote), that is, it is notified such that it is able to junk product will be lost in carrousel at once Fetch.Contrastingly, the hackney vehicle that traditional taxi driver drives, after often there are user's lost objects, does not have in the short time It is found, until, it is necessary to search taxi ticket when finding, after finding taxi ticket, contacting taxi company, then taxi is public Department contact taxi driver, finally may lost objects cannot give for change, even if or giving lost objects for change and also consuming very big Human and material resources etc..
